Top Valentine’s Gifts for Kids: Spread Love and Joy with Thoughtful Presents

Valentine’s Gifts for Kids

Valentine’s Gifts for Kids

Valentine’s Day is not just for adults – it’s a wonderful opportunity to show love and appreciation to the little ones in your life as well. If you’re looking for the perfect Valentine’s gift for a child, here are some ideas that are sure to bring a smile to their face:

Personalised Gifts

A personalised gift adds a special touch to Valentine’s Day. Consider getting a customised teddy bear, storybook, or piece of jewellery with the child’s name or initials engraved on it.

Craft Kits

Encourage creativity with Valentine’s-themed craft kits. From making heart-shaped cards to creating friendship bracelets, these kits provide hours of fun and allow children to express their artistic side.

Stuffed Animals

A cuddly stuffed animal is always a hit with kids. Choose one in the shape of a heart or featuring Valentine’s Day colours to make it extra festive.

Books about Love and Friendship

Books are a timeless gift that can inspire and educate children. Look for stories about love, friendship, and kindness that will warm their hearts on Valentine’s Day.

Sweet Treats

No Valentine’s Day is complete without some sweet treats! Consider gifting heart-shaped chocolates, cookies, or candies that the child can enjoy as a special treat.

Remember, the most important thing about giving gifts on Valentine’s Day is the thought and love behind them. Whether big or small, your gesture will surely make the child feel cherished and loved.

Choosing the Perfect Gift for a 3-Year-Old Boy: Thoughtful Ideas to Bring Joy

Choosing the Perfect Gift for a 3-Year-Old Boy

Choosing the Perfect Gift for a 3-Year-Old Boy

When it comes to finding the ideal gift for a 3-year-old boy, it’s essential to consider his interests, developmental stage, and safety. Here are some thoughtful gift ideas that are sure to bring joy to any young boy:

Educational Toys

Encourage learning through play with educational toys such as building blocks, puzzles, or interactive books. These gifts not only entertain but also help develop cognitive skills and creativity.

Outdoor Play Equipment

Boost his physical activity and imagination with outdoor play equipment like a mini slide, tricycle, or a sandbox. These gifts promote active play and exploration.

Role-Playing Sets

Foster his imagination with role-playing sets such as a doctor kit, toolset, or kitchen playset. These gifts allow him to engage in pretend play, enhancing social skills and creativity.

Stuffed Animals

A cuddly stuffed animal can be a comforting companion for a young boy. Choose one in his favourite animal or character to make it extra special.

Musical Instruments

Nurture his love for music with child-friendly musical instruments like drums, xylophone, or keyboard. Music can stimulate creativity and sensory development.

Remember to always consider safety when selecting gifts for young children. Opt for age-appropriate toys that are durable and free from small parts that could pose a choking hazard.

By choosing a gift that aligns with his interests and developmental stage, you can create memorable moments of joy and learning for the special 3-year-old boy in your life.
